How we all wish we were able to buy more time for ourselves, like every day. Well, today is the day when we all are granted this particular wish.

The last day of June will have an extra second, or a “leap” second added to it as the earth’s rotation is slowing down a bit.

A leap second is inserted either on June 30 or December 31.

As we all know, the clock normally moves from 23:59:59 to 00:00:00 the next day. However, with the leap second on June 30, Coordinated Universal Time (UTC) will move from 23:59:59 to 23:59:60 and then to 00:00:00 on July 1. Because of this extra second, many systems are supposedly going to be turned off for one second.
